Linux x86_64; rv:60.0) Gecko/20100101 Thunderbird/60.7.0 MIME-Version: 1.0 In-Reply-To: Content-Type: text/plain; charset=utf-8 Content-Language: en-US Content-Transfer-Encoding: 8bit X-Bogosity: Ham, tests=bogofilter, spamicity=0.000000, version=1.2.4 Sender: owner-linux-mm@kvack.org Precedence: bulk X-Loop: owner-majordomo@kvack.org List-ID: On 6/17/19 8:54 AM, Andy Lutomirski wrote: >>> Would that mean that with Meltdown affected CPUs we open speculation >>> attacks against the mmlocal memory from KVM user space? >> Not necessarily. There would likely be a _set_ of local PGDs. We could >> still have pair of PTI PGDs just like we do know, they'd just be a local >> PGD pair. >> > Unfortunately, this would mean that we need to sync twice as many > top-level entries when we context switch. Yeah, PTI sucks. :) For anyone following along at home, I'm going to go off into crazy per-cpu-pgds speculation mode now... Feel free to stop reading now. :) But, I was thinking we could get away with not doing this on _every_ context switch at least. For instance, couldn't 'struct tlb_context' have PGD pointer (or two with PTI) in addition to the TLB info? That way we only do the copying when we change the context. Or does that tie the implementation up too much with PCIDs?
